Marlowe Granados is a writer and filmmaker. She is the author of Happy Hour, a novel the New York Times called “confident, charismatic and alive to the pleasure of observation.” Her advice column "Designs for Living," appears in The Baffler. After spending time in New York and London, Granados currently resides in Toronto. She co-hosts The Mean Reds, a podcast dedicated to women-led films.
